Product Description

This Icatu lot made for a very well balanced brew at both City and Full City. The grounds had notes of dark cocoa and chocolate hazelnut spread, while the wet aroma was accented by notes of pistachio, and honey. At City roast level, the brewed coffee has a very nice butter caramel note at its core that leads into mild top notes of toffee almond, and nougat. The cup has fairly mild acidity, though light roasts have a hint of citrus. Full City roasts should make phenomenal single origin espresso (SO). The cup sweetness still comes through strong, and finds equal footing with a mix of semi sweet and high % cacao type chocolates. Body is boosted quite a bit too, while acidity is completely flattened. Perfect for espresso or milk drinks. This description is from the cupping notes of our coffee importer, Sweet Maria's
